The Billings Estate National Historic Site is a heritage museum in Ottawa, Ontario, Canada.
Billings became prosperous in the timber trade and built the large home that was named Park Hill.
Over time the property was slowly sold off to developers, and today the estate retains only a relatively small plot of land.
The house is included amongst other architecturally interesting and historically significant buildings in Doors Open Ottawa, held each year in early June.
Very few of the artifacts owned by the Billings Estate National Historic Site are on display at any given time.
